The Benefits of Working with a Small Law Firm
One of the biggest advantages of working with a small firm is the personalized attention you receive. Your matter won’t get lost in the shuffle. You’ll work directly with an experienced attorney who understands your business, your industry, and your goals inside and out.
Small firms are often more flexible and adaptable to your needs. Whether you need help with a one-off contract, ongoing legal counsel, or advice on navigating complex tech or regulatory issues, small firms can tailor services to fit your specific situation. We’re not bound by rigid processes or layers of bureaucracy, which means quicker responses and solutions.
Another benefit? Cost efficiency. Small firms tend to have lower overhead costs than large firms, which translates to more competitive rates. We focus on delivering practical solutions that align with your business priorities—without unnecessary extras.
Small doesn’t mean limited. Many small firms, including mine, specialize in niche areas like business and technology law. This means you get the high-level expertise you’d expect from a large firm, but with a more personalized and responsive approach.
